Mischievous elements in Taraba want Ag Gov Umar stopped – Delegate

By Emeka Nze

A delegate at the ongoing National Conference from Taraba state nominated on the platform of former Senators’ Forum, Senator Abdullahi Bala Adamu, has called on the people of the state to rally round the Acting Governor of the state, Alhaji Garba Umar, to ensure that citizens of the state can co-exist in an atmosphere of peace devoid of suspicion.
Adamu, who was speaking in a chat with Blueprint yesterday at the conference, blamed those who have the ambition to take over the reins of power in the state come 2015 to be responsible for all mischief and propaganda in the state.
He said what is important was to deploy the state’s resources to make life better for the people of the state.

The delegate who described the allegation against the Acting Governor of instigating citizens to violence as “laughable” noted that nobody in power enjoys wanton destruction of lives and property during his tenure.
He explained that government is founded on three cardinal principles, namely, the protection of lives and property, safeguarding the dignity of the citizens  and welfare adding that every leader wants the improvements of lives of its people and Taraba government will not be an exception.

According to the Senator Bala Adamu, those behind the mischief in the state were the same people who tried to hide the truth from the people of Taraba by giving the erroneous impression that the ailing governor, Danbaba Suntai, was fit to govern the state.

He accused those who plotted to stampede the ailing governor to resume his duties as governor of the state while he is yet to fully recover of playing on the conscience of Tarabans and enjoined the citizens of the state in particular and Nigerians in general to continue to pray for the governor.
He explained that it is an attempt by the enemies of the state to prevent the Acting Governor from taking the full reins of power in the state reminding them that power comes from God.
